def save(self): path = self.projectPath if not os.path.exists(path): os.makedirs(path) filePath = os.path.join(self.projectPath, config.PMX_DESCRIPTOR_NAME) plist.writePlist(self.dataHash(), filePath)
def save(self, namespace): #TODO: Si puedo garantizar el guardado con el manager puedo controlar los mtime en ese punto dir = os.path.dirname(self.path(namespace)) if not os.path.exists(dir): os.makedirs(dir) plist.writePlist(self.hash, self.path(namespace)) self.updateMtime(namespace)
def save(self): path = self.projectPath if not os.path.exists(path): os.makedirs(path) filePath = os.path.join(self.projectPath, self.FILE) plist.writePlist(self.hash, filePath)
def save(self): path = self.projectPath if not os.path.exists(path): os.makedirs(path) filePath = os.path.join(self.projectPath, self.FILE) plist.writePlist(self.dataHash(), filePath)
def save(self, namespace): if not os.path.exists(self.path(namespace)): os.makedirs(self.path(namespace)) projectFile = os.path.join(self.path(namespace), self.FILE) plist.writePlist(self.hash, projectFile) #Hora los archivos del project for projectFile in self.files: if projectFile.path != self.path(namespace): projectFile.save(self.path(namespace)) #TODO: Si puedo garantizar el guardado con el manager puedo controlar los mtime en ese punto self.updateMtime(namespace)
def save(self, namespace): folder = os.path.dirname(self.path(namespace)) if not os.path.exists(folder): os.makedirs(folder) plist.writePlist(self.hash, self.path(namespace))
def save(self, namespace): if not os.path.exists(self.path(namespace)): os.makedirs(self.path(namespace)) file = os.path.join(self.path(namespace), self.FILE) plist.writePlist(self.hash, file) self.updateMtime(namespace)
def sync(self): plist.writePlist(self.settings, self.file)
def write(self, path): plist.writePlist(self, path)
def writePlist(hashData, path): return plist.writePlist(hashData, path)
def writePlist(self, hashData, path): # TODO Ver que pasa con este set que falta self.plistFileCache.set(path, hashData) return plist.writePlist(hashData, path)